tutorial

What is 401 Unauthorized Error? How to Fix it? (4 Easy Fixes)

Kongsi

Facing 401 Unauthorized Error?

Here’s the fix. But first, listen to this:

Tidak dinafikan, anda telah menemui satu atau dua ralat semasa melayari laman web kegemaran anda dalam talian. Kesalahan ini adalah gangguan biasa yang tidak disukai oleh webmaster dan pengguna.

Namun, ketidakselesaan ini berjaya bertahan dan terus menyusahkan orang bahkan hingga hari ini.

Tetapi apa sebenarnya kod ralat yang terus muncul entah dari mana dan tanpa menjelaskan mengapa ia muncul di tempat pertama?

Ringkasnya, Internet atau World Wide Web berfungsi berdasarkan protokol aplikasi yang dirancang untuk sistem maklumat hipermedia yang diedarkan dan kolaboratif, atau dikenali sebagai HTTP atau Hypertext Transfer Protocol.

Dengan kata lain, HTTP membolehkan komunikasi antara pelanggan dan pelayan sehingga memungkinkan pemindahan data antara kedua-duanya dengan lancar.

Namun, apabila terdapat masalah komunikasi di suatu tempat, ralat berlaku ditandai sebagai kod status respons. Kesalahan yang paling biasa adalah kesalahan 4xx yang mewakili masalah atau masalah. Dengan ini, mari kita fokus pada ralat 401 yang tidak dibenarkan dan bagaimana membetulkannya.

Jenis ralat 4xx

Kesalahan atau kod status yang bermula dengan angka 4 seringkali merujuk kepada kesalahan pelanggan. Dengan kata lain, masalah ada kaitan dengan permintaan pelanggan atau secara langsung disebabkan oleh pelanggan itu sendiri.

Lebih-lebih lagi, kesilapan ini mungkin menunjukkan jika keadaan itu sementara atau kekal. Berikut adalah beberapa contoh 400 kod ralat.

  • ralat 400: Permintaan Buruk - Dalam kes ini, pelayan tidak akan atau tidak dapat memproses permintaan tersebut kerana pelbagai alasan, seperti pembingkaian pesanan permintaan tidak sah, permintaan sintaks yang salah bentuk, permintaan perutean yang menipu dan sebagainya. Ringkasnya, pelayan tidak memahami apa yang anda mahukan darinya.
  • ralat 401: Tidak dibenarkan - Fokus topik kami hari ini kesalahan 401 adalah serupa dengan kesalahan 403 Dilarang. Ia berlaku semasa anda cuba log masuk dengan kelayakan yang salah terlalu banyak sehingga pelayan memutuskan untuk menjauhkan anda. Anda mungkin membuat kesalahan ketik sangat memalukan anda. Penguncian ini bersifat sementara dan biasanya berlangsung selama 30 minit atau lebih. Masalah sebenarnya adalah apabila anda mendapat ralat ini tetapi anda pasti tidak melakukan kesalahan.
  • ralat 403: Dilarang - Semuanya baik-baik saja tetapi pelayan enggan mengambil tindakan. Mengapa, pelayan, mengapa? The isu yang paling biasa di sini mungkin terdapat masalah dengan konfigurasi kebenaran. Ringkasnya, pelayan menganggap bahawa anda tidak mempunyai kebenaran untuk mengakses sumber tanpa mengira pengesahan anda.
  • ralat 404: Not Found – The all-time famous “Oops, something went wrong” or “Sorry, the page could not be found” error is probably the most common type of client status codes. As you probably guessed, this error occurs when the resource doesn’t exist or it isn’t available at the moment but may be so in the future.

Sekarang kita mempunyai pemahaman yang lebih baik mengenai kod ralat sial ini, inilah masanya untuk memberi tumpuan kepada yang 401 dan bagaimana menyingkirkannya.

Memperbaiki kod ralat 401: Perspektif pengguna

Seperti yang telah disebutkan sebelumnya, jika anda mengalami kesalahan 401, ini biasanya bermaksud anda telah memberikan kelayakan log masuk yang tidak dapat dikenali oleh pelayan.

Walau bagaimanapun, apa yang berlaku apabila anda sebenarnya memberikan bukti kelayakan masuk yang betul tetapi pelayan masih memberi anda mesej yang tidak dibenarkan?

Ini menunjukkan masalah yang lebih mendalam daripada typo sederhana. Ini bermaksud bahawa pelayan web mungkin tidak menerima bukti kelayakan anda kerana masalah penyemak imbas sehingga memutuskan untuk sedikit sebanyak mengganggu anda.

Terdapat beberapa cara untuk mencuba mengatasi masalah ini dan berikut adalah contoh masing-masing.

1. Periksa URL

  • Dalam beberapa kes, anda menaip URL (Uniform Resource Locator) di penyemak imbas secara manual atau anda mempunyai penanda halaman URL yang ketinggalan zaman sehingga anda menggunakannya. Ini adalah kesalahan biasa yang dapat diperbaiki dengan memeriksa kesalahan ejaan atau memeriksa apakah URL masih dapat dilaksanakan.

2. Periksa kelayakan log masuk anda

  • Anda pasti terkejut kerana kesalahan ketik adalah sebab yang paling biasa di sebalik masalah 401 kami. Kesalahan ejaan dalam tauliah dapat dielakkan dengan menggunakan alat seperti Dashlane - anda tidak perlu menaip semula kelayakan setiap kali anda log masuk.

3. Kosongkan sejarah penyemakan imbas dan kuki

  • Hari ini, tidak ada yang membersihkan sejarah penyemakan imbas atau kuki lagi dan secara praktikal. Selain mengumpulkan banyak sampah digital dari masa ke masa, kebiasaan ini juga boleh menyebabkan masalah ralat 401 ketika anda cuba log masuk ke laman web apa sahaja yang anda suka. Faktanya adalah bahawa kuki adalah potongan yang menyimpan beberapa maklumat peribadi anda, termasuk kelayakan masuk. Mereka boleh mengingatkan laman web tentang siapa anda tetapi mereka tidak selalu berfungsi dengan betul. Sekiranya anda mendapat 401 tetapi anda yakin itu bukan kesalahan ketik, cuba kosongkan sejarah penyemakan imbas, kuki dan cache, kemudian cuba lagi. Inilah cara anda boleh melakukannya.
  • Untuk Mozilla Firefox - Navigasi ke menu hamburger, klik Pilihan, pergi ke Privasi dan Tetapan dan cari Sejarah, klik Hapus Sejarah dan pilih Segala-galanya untuk menghilangkan kuki sepenuhnya.

  • Untuk Google Chrome – Got to the dot menu in the upper-right corner, click on it, select Settings > Advanced > Clear Browsing Data.

  • Untuk Safari - Cukup klik pada Clear History di menu History dan anda sudah siap.

4. Siram DNS

  • Punca lain untuk kesalahan 401 ialah masalah pelayan DNS (Domain Name System). Nasib baik, masalah ini agak mudah diselesaikan.
  • Untuk pengguna Windows OS - Log masuk ke komputer anda sebagai pentadbir. Ketik "CMD" di bar carian untuk membuka Command Prompt. Setelah berada di Command Prompt, ketik "ipconfig / flushdns" berikut dan tekan enter.

  • Untuk pengguna Mac OS - Tekan Command dan Spacebar untuk membuka carian Spotlight. Sebaik sahaja ketik "Terminal". Di antara muka arahan, ketik yang berikut: “sudo killall -HUP mDNSReply".
  • Juga, adakah anda telah mencuba mematikannya dan menghidupkannya semula?

Memperbaiki ralat 401: Perspektif webmaster

Sekarang setelah kita membahas ralat 401 yang tidak dibenarkan dan bagaimana memperbaikinya dari sisi pelanggan, mari kita lihat apa yang boleh dilakukan oleh webmaster untuk menyingkirkan kesilapan ini.

Kembali ke versi sebelumnya

  • Sering kali, webmaster menggunakan CMS (Content Management System) seperti WordPress, untuk menjalankan perniagaan mereka. Setiap CMS memerlukan kemas kini dari semasa ke semasa dan kemas kini ini dapat memperkenalkan bug baru selain dari yang telah mereka perbaiki. Dengan kata lain, tidak jarang kemas kini menyebabkan kesalahan 401. Sekiranya demikian, cukup kembali ke versi sebelumnya sebelum mengemas kini di mana semuanya berfungsi dengan baik.

Nyahpasang perubahan

  • Platform CMS, seperti WordPress yang paling popular, mempunyai pelbagai add-on yang dapat membantu webmaster keluar. Alat tambah ini merangkumi tema, pemalam, widget dan sebagainya. Seperti yang anda bayangkan, mana-mana add-on pihak ketiga boleh menyebabkan konflik dengan sistem yang mana satu adalah kesalahan 401. Dalam senario seperti itu, hapus pemasangan tambahan yang mungkin menyebabkan ralat.

Kesan kesilapan pada pengguna

Kesalahan cukup menyusahkan, untuk membuatnya lebih ringan. Mereka boleh mengganggu pengguna dan memberi kesan negatif yang besar terhadap kepuasan dan pengalaman mereka secara keseluruhan, walaupun kesalahan berlaku kerana pengguna melakukan kesalahan.

Namun, halaman kesalahan dan mesej dapat dibuat menarik dan bahkan menghibur, untuk mengurangkan dan mengurangkan kekecewaan pengguna.

Itulah sebabnya pembangun membuat halaman tersuai untuk mesej ralat. Sebagai contoh, anda dapat mengubah deskripsi meta untuk halaman ralat untuk memberi pengguna konteks di sebalik ralat, serta petunjuk untuk kemungkinan penyelesaian masalah yang dihadapi.

But where’s the fun in that? Indeed, a dull message describing a solution to the error may be off-putting, to say the least. That’s why developers oftentimes go a step further to ease the users’ pain.

  • Sebagai contoh, halaman ralat 404 Android membolehkan anda bermain bodoh tetapi tetap permainan yang menghiburkan. Sekiranya anda tersandung pada halaman ralat, sebaiknya anda memanfaatkannya.

  • Satu lagi contoh ialah Halaman ralat Slack. Walaupun pemandangan yang berwarna-warni dengan babi dan ayam yang interaktif dapat menimbulkan kekecewaan anda lebih jauh, anda tidak dapat menahan tawa gembira.
  • Sekiranya anda mahukan hiburan, lihat halaman kesalahan Kualo. Syarikat hosting web ini membolehkan anda bermain legenda penceroboh ruang jenis permainan malah mendapat potongan harga sekiranya anda mencapai skor tinggi.

Dalam apa jua keadaan, bahkan ketidaknyamanan dapat menjadi kesempatan untuk membalikkan keadaan dan mengubah kekecewaan pengguna menjadi frustrasi yang tidak begitu banyak.

Kesimpulan

Pada akhirnya, ini menunjukkan betapa kreatifnya anda dan bagaimana anda merancang untuk mendekati keseluruhan kesilapan. Kesalahan akan terus berlaku tidak kira sekeras mana pun anda berusaha untuk menghindarinya.

Tidak perlu dikatakan bahawa sekurang-kurangnya yang boleh anda lakukan adalah melakukan yang terbaik untuk memperbaikinya sebelum pengguna menggunakan obor dan pitchforks.

Kesalahan 401 yang tidak dibenarkan adalah perkara biasa dan kebanyakannya disebabkan oleh ketidakmampuan pengguna untuk memasukkan maklumat kelayakan masuk mereka dengan sabar. Namun, ralat ini boleh berlaku dengan alasan lain juga.

Itulah sebabnya penting untuk memahami cara mendekati masalah, serta memahami cara menyelesaikannya dengan betul.

Chris Wagner

I am Chris Wagner, Having 12+ years of experience in the Hosting industry.

diterbitkan oleh
Chris Wagner

Recent Posts

9 Best Student Hosting for 2025

Hello, Gen Z! Ready to fly high with your dreams? Let no one stop you…

bulan 7 lalu

5 Best HideMyAss Alternatives (#3 is Just Awesome)

Let's talk about HideMyAss Alternatives! But first, let us talk about HideMyAss. If you’re interested…

bulan 7 lalu

Kadence WP Review (2025)

These days the theme market is flooded and users are spoiled by choices. But if…

bulan 7 lalu

10 Laman Web Hosting Video Terbaik

Thinking of starting a video log or want to host your video on a video…

bulan 7 lalu

9 Penyedia Hosting E-dagang Terbaik pada 2025

So, you‘re looking for the best ecommerce hosting company for your needs? No matter whether…

bulan 7 lalu

Turnkey Internet Review: My Honest Opinion + Pros & Cons

Mengapa Mempercayai Kami "Kami telah menjadi pelanggan yang membayar Turnkey Internet since March 2019.…

bulan 7 lalu